Single External Battery Mods FAQs
Single external battery mods are vaping devices that use a single removable battery to power the device. These mods offer a balance between portability, power, and flexibility. Here are some key points to consider.
Removable Batteries
Single external battery mods require users to insert and remove a single rechargeable battery. Most mods use the most common batteries but some devices may accommodate alternative batteries.
Variable Wattage and Features
Single battery mods are typically regulated devices, offering variable wattage, temperature control, and other customisable features. These devices allow users to adjust the power output to achieve their preferred vaping experience.
Battery Life
The battery life of a single external battery mod depends on factors such as the battery capacity, the wattage used, and vaping habits. Higher-capacity batteries generally provide longer usage between charges.
Battery Replacement
Users can easily replace the battery when it reaches the end of its lifespan. Having a spare battery allows for continuous use while the other battery is charging.
Versatility
Single-battery mods are versatile and can accommodate a wide range of tanks and atomisers. They are suitable for both mouth-to-lung (MTL) and direct-to-lung (DTL) vaping styles.
Portability
Single-battery mods are often more portable and compact than mods with multiple external batteries. They are suitable for vapers who prioritise a smaller form factor and lighter weight.
Power Limitations
While single-battery mods provide sufficient power for many vapers, they may have limitations when it comes to high-wattage vaping. Users who enjoy very high wattages or extended vaping sessions may find that dual or triple-battery mods better suit their needs.
Ease of Use
Single-battery mods are often considered more straightforward for beginners compared to mods with multiple batteries. There's no need to worry about pairing batteries or understanding power configurations.
Charging
Single-battery mods can be charged internally via USB or externally. External charging is recommended for safety reasons and to extend its lifespan.
Considerations for Sub-Ohm Vaping
Single-battery mods are often used for sub-ohm vaping, but users should be mindful of their chosen coil resistance and wattage to ensure they stay within the safe limits of their battery.
